Sainz doubts Red Bull-Honda deal will impact future
Carlos Sainz Jr. doubts Red Bull's newly-announced engine deal with Honda for 2019 will have any impact on his future, with the team still retaining an option on the Spaniard's services for next season. Sainz joined Renault for the final four races of last year as a makeweight in the deal that saw Toro Rosso and McLaren swap engine supplies for 2018, with his deal at the French team extending through to the end of the season. Red Bull retains an option on recalling the on-loan Sainz for 2019, potentially as a replacement for Daniel Ricciardo should the Australian opt to leave.
